Allocating investments to companies that reflect your beliefs and values can be empowering, but as companies realize “going green” attracts investor money, many have been accused of “greenwashing”. Greenwashing is when an organization claims to be environmentally friendly, but in reality, hasn’t made any notable sustainability effort.
Responsible investing, also known as 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) Investing, is a socially conscious way to align your financial goals with your non-financial goals.
